Hello plugin authors,

Next Thursday, Corbexa will run a disaster-recovery drill for the RestockRoute vending-machine restock planner. During the failover window, plugin callbacks will be replayed against the standby scheduler, so please ensure your handlers are idempotent and tolerate duplicate route assignments. No customer restock data will be altered. To re-register your plugin against the standby environment during the drill, authenticate with the recovery passphrase provided below.

vault phrase of hahip-tajeg = quenax-briath-briax

Baseline file: lintbase.json, generated by Quillcheck. Do not edit by hand. Regenerate only after intentional rule changes, then commit alongside the rule diff. Plugins that add findings must update the baseline in the same PR or CI fails. Regeneration hits the internal Quillcheck baseline service, which requires authentication. Use the following key for that call.

API key for yahig-tadup: kto7_ubizbYm

// LOCKER_GRANT_TTL_SECONDS
// Max lifetime of a FreshFold locker access grant. Keep short:
// grants are minted when the courier scans the bay, and a stale
// grant lets anyone reopen the door after pickup. 90s covers the
// slowest observed load cycle at the Darrow Street hub plus margin.
// Do not raise without updating the kiosk countdown, which hardcodes
// the same value. Last tuned against the build noted below.

session token of kageg-kajep = htk31_8e387f741d208554faee18934428597